The present study seeks to assess the Opportunity Index and Equity Index of Opportunity by using the social opportunity function approach for the two important dimensions of human development i.e. Education and Health. The study used Pakistan Social and Living Standards Measurement surveys of 2005-06 and 2019-20.The results for the Opportunity Index indicated an increase in the average opportunities in education between two time periods. While the equity index of opportunity depicted an improvement for literacy and at both the primary and secondary levels of education. Access to health opportunities in terms of access to immunization and treatment for diarrhea has increased, along with an improvement in their Equity index of opportunities. The findings of the study show an increase in the average opportunities among the two aforementioned dimensions as compared to the base period, yet there is a need to pay more attention on the equitable distribution of such opportunities among the whole population.
